SEMIOTICS OF THE OBJECT POSTER STYLE

_______________________________________________________________________


Object: Inherent Meaning
     +
Word: Identity

The object (image) holds an inherent meaning (object/functionality) within itself.

The word identifies the object.


Juxtaposition is also a form of association :

An image (object sign)) holds an inherent meaning, its own identifier, but also a subjective / associative meaning.

word likewise, holds inherent meaning as well as subject / associative meaning. 


When juxtaposed next to one another, images and words can transfer their associative meanings to each other,creating a third meaning that transcends the original inherent and associative meanings.

PROJECT INTRODUCTION

The object poster, as exemplified by the Priester matches poster designed by Lucien Bernhard, is the beginning of the modern graphic designer's exploration of the relationship between word and image. 

PROJECT DESCRIPTION

To begin this design project, choose an object you have familiarity with. 

Render it in simple colored shapes without outlines, visually reduced and edited down to its visual essence as an object. Do not interpret and/or express yourself through the object, 
but visually represent the object as it is. 

Juxtapose the image with a word – 
– Version 1 with a word which identifies the image. 
– Version 2 with a word which signifies the image and changes the nuance, 
   meaning and/or interpretation of the image. 

Choose a typeface that is legible and easy to read so that it communicates as text, but alsoappropriately signifies the word's relationship with the image. Juxtapose the word with 
the image in a straightforward way, position it level, placed close to and/or if appropriate touching the image so they unify as a singular composition. Choose a color for the background of the design, that provides an appropriate context and objectively conveys the inherent and implied meaning of the word and the object.
